腾讯云轻量应用服务器:构建多站部署的艺术
在数字化时代,企业与个人用户对网站的需求日益增长。作为云计算领域的领导者,腾讯云提供了强大的轻量应用服务器,为用户轻松搭建和管理多个网站提供了高效且灵活的解决方案。这里将首先阐述结论,然后深入探讨如何在腾讯云轻量应用服务器上实现多站部署。
结论:
腾讯云轻量应用服务器(简称COS)以其高性能、低成本和易于管理的优势,使得在单一服务器上部署多个网站变得轻而易举。通过合理的规划和配置,用户能够实现资源的最大利用,提升网站性能,并确保各站点之间的隔离性。
详细分析:
-
环境准备:
首先,登录腾讯云控制台,选择“服务器”类别,找到轻量应用服务器产品。购买并创建一个新的实例,根据需求选择合适的配置,如CPU、内存、带宽等。 -
操作系统和Web服务器安装:
在服务器创建完成后,可通过SSH连接进行操作。选择Linux系统(如Ubuntu或CentOS),安装Apache、Nginx或PHP-FPM等Web服务器软件,这将为你的网站提供运行环境。 -
域名绑定:
对每个要部署的网站,需要为其申请独立的域名或者子域名,并在腾讯云DNS管理中进行解析,指向对应的服务器IP地址。 -
网站文件上传和配置:
将每个网站的源代码上传至服务器的不同目录,如www/website1、www/website2等。对于不同的域名,设置相应的虚拟主机配置,指定监听端口和文档根目录。 -
安全性设置:
为了保护网站安全,可以启用SSL证书,设置防火墙规则,限制不必要的网络访问,以及定期备份数据。 -
负载均衡:
如果流量较大,可以考虑使用腾讯云的负载均衡服务,将流量分散到多个服务器,提高整体性能和可用性。 -
监控和优化:
使用腾讯云的监控工具,定期检查服务器性能和网站访问情况,根据数据进行调优,如调整缓存策略、优化数据库查询等。
总结:
在腾讯云轻量应用服务器上搭建多个网站并非难事,关键在于合理规划和精细管理。通过上述步骤,不仅可以实现资源的最大化利用,还能确保各站点的独立性和安全性。腾讯云的强大功能和易用性使得这个过程变得更加便捷,为企业和个人开发者提供了强大而灵活的平台。
秒懂云